What is Quackerbox Creations?
Founded in 1982 by John and Betsy Drake, Quackerbox Creations leverages over four decades of screen printing expertise and a strong foundation in visual arts. The company prides itself on customer-centricity and has consistently invested in cutting-edge technology to offer a diverse range of printing effects, from trendy designs to classic aesthetics. While rooted in artistic principles, Quackerbox Creations' strength lies in its ability to meet and exceed client expectations, fostering a loyal customer base that has fueled its sustained prosperity. The unique, animal-friendly environment, complete with shop cats and miniature guard dogs, adds a distinctive charm to its operations.
